Slab Leveling in Des Moines, IA
Slab leveling services are designed to address uneven or sinking concrete surfaces commonly found on residential properties. This service is often requested for dri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ors that have developed cracks, dips, or tilting over time. Property owners typically seek slab leveling to restore a safe, level surface, improve curb appeal, and prevent further damage caused by shifting or settling of the ground beneath the concrete.
Before requesting slab leveling,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the unevenness and whether the existing concrete can be effectively restored without needing replacement. It's also important to consider the age and condition of the slab, as well as any underlying soil issues that may influence the success of leveling. Proper assessment helps determine if the project will provide a long-lasting solution and ensures the surface remains stable for years to come.

Slab Leveling Questions
What is slab leveling? Slab leveling involves raising and stabilizing sunken or uneven concrete slabs to restore a smooth, level surface.
Which projects typically require slab leveling? Common projects include dri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ors that have settled or cracked over time.
How can I tell if my concrete needs leveling? Signs include uneven surfaces, cracks, or gaps between slabs that suggest sinking or shifting.
Is slab leveling a permanent solution? Properly performed slab leveling can provide a long-lasting correction for uneven concrete surfaces.
